[<<Previous Entry] [^^Up^^] [Next Entry>>] [Menu] [About The Guide]
Int 41  - System Data - Hard Disk 0 Parameter Table                        [B]


Note:  the default parameter table array is located at F000h:E401h in 100%
     compatible BIOSes; the pointer may be overridden by the hard disk
     controller's BIOS to support drive formats unknown to the ROM BIOS

See Also: INT 13/AH=09h,INT 1E,INT 46

Format of fixed disk parameters:
Offset Size    Description
 00h   WORD    number of cylinders
 02h   BYTE    number of heads
 03h   WORD    starting reduced write current cylinder (XT only, 0 for others)
 05h   WORD    starting write precompensation cylinder number
 07h   BYTE    maximum ECC burst length (XT only)
 08h   BYTE    control byte
          bits 0-2: drive option (XT only, 0 for others)
          bit 3:    set if more than 8 heads (AT and later only)
          bit 4:    always 0
          bit 5:    set if manufacturer's defect map on max cylinder+1
                (AT and later only)
          bit 6:    disable ECC retries
          bit 7:    disable access retries
 09h   BYTE    standard timeout (XT only, 0 for others)
 0Ah   BYTE    formatting timeout (XT and WD1002 only, 0 for others)
 0Bh   BYTE    timeout for checking drive (XT and WD1002 only, 0 for others)
 0Ch   WORD    cylinder number of landing zone (AT and later only)
 0Eh   BYTE    number of sectors per track (AT and later only)
 0Fh   BYTE    reserved

This page created by ng2html v1.05, the Norton guide to HTML conversion utility. Written by Dave Pearson